Our client is looking to recruit an experienced MOT Tester/Vehicle Technician for a franchised motor dealership in Crawley. This is a massive opportunity for the right person to join a fantastic employer.

  • MUST hold a valid MOT licence
  • A full UK driving licence
  • Own your own tools
  • The ability to interact with our customers effectively
  • Experience of working in a team
